Is the Pretender episode 41 or 48?
There was a difference in the number of episodes of The Pretender. The producer's version had a total of 41 episodes, each of which was about 45 minutes long. However, since Hunan TV's episodes were not 45 minutes long, they would broadcast 49 episodes. In addition, the satellite version had a total of 48 episodes, each episode ranging from 27 to 60 minutes long. The difference in the number of episodes between these different versions was mainly due to differences in editing and broadcasting platforms. Therefore, there were both 41 and 48 episodes of The Pretender, and it was up to one's personal preference which version to watch.

Is The Pretender episode 41 or 48?
There were two versions of The Pretender. One was the producer's version with 41 episodes and each episode was about 45 minutes long. The other was the TV version with 48 episodes and each episode was about 30 minutes long. The difference between the two versions was the length of the story and the reduction of the plot. The producer version had a longer episode and a relatively complete plot, while the TV version had cut and re-edited some plots, resulting in an increase in the number of episodes and a shorter episode. Therefore, there was a 41-episode production version of The Pretender and a 48-episode TV version.

The Pretender, the Three Heroines
The three female leads of The Pretender were Cheng Jinyun, Yu Manli, and Ming Jing. Cheng Jinyun was played by Wang Lejun, Yu Manli was played by Song Yi, and Ming Jing was played by Liu Mintao.
